Output e234d1ba80fcbd11ca78335402deb8f3bf59d0a2e373b8f177dad48b066f6ff3:0

value
2682802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0e1d4ea07a704bffd40bff501dddee8a874fc7 OP_EQUAL
address
3BT58m64SVgtDjZdPkjEGX8DPF3qvLnD1M
transaction
e234d1ba80fcbd11ca78335402deb8f3bf59d0a2e373b8f177dad48b066f6ff3
spent
true